Gene Gene information from NCBI Gene database.
Entrez ID 55247
Gene name Nei like DNA glycosylase 3
Gene symbol NEIL3
Synonyms (NCBI Gene)
FGP2FPG2NEI3ZGRF3hFPG2hNEI3
Chromosome 4
Chromosome location 4q34.3
Summary NEIL3 belongs to a class of DNA glycosylases homologous to the bacterial Fpg/Nei family. These glycosylases initiate the first step in base excision repair by cleaving bases damaged by reactive oxygen species and introducing a DNA strand break via the ass

Protein name Endonuclease 8-like 3 (EC 3.2.2.-) (EC 4.2.99.18) (DNA glycosylase FPG2) (DNA glycosylase/AP lyase Neil3) (Endonuclease VIII-like 3) (Nei-like protein 3)
Protein function DNA glycosylase which prefers single-stranded DNA (ssDNA), or partially ssDNA structures such as bubble and fork structures, to double-stranded DNA (dsDNA) (PubMed:12433996, PubMed:19170771, PubMed:22569481, PubMed:23755964). Mediates interstran

Tissue specificity TISSUE SPECIFICITY: Expressed in keratinocytes and embryonic fibroblasts (at protein level). Also detected in thymus, testis and fetal lung primary fibroblasts. {ECO:0000269|PubMed:12433996, ECO:0000269|PubMed:16428305, ECO:0000269|PubMed:19426544, ECO:00
